[dev1000] Dynamis Reborn!
Adjustments:
Reservations will no longer be required to enter the above areas.
New key items will replace the "Timeless Hourglass" and "Perpetual Hourglass" items needed for entry.
The key items need only be obtained once.
It will be made available at an affordable price via the Goblin NPCs presently dealing in hourglasses.
Time restriction for entry will be changed to once per Earth day.
Trigger items will be introduced as a new spawn condition for certain notorious monsters (NMs).
Monster distribution will receive drastic revisions.
Monsters will yield experience points (excluding certain NMs).
